The most common signs and symptoms of laryngitis are hoarseness, loss of voice, and throat pain. http://www.britishvoiceassociation.org.uk/voicecare_reflux-and-voice.htm WebThis process is referred to as gastro-oesophageal reflux (GOR). However, in some people, small amounts of stomach juice can spill back into the upper throat (pharynx) affecting the back of the voice box (larynx) causing irritation and hoarseness. This is known as laryngo-pharyngeal reflux (LPR). It is often called 'silent reflux' because many ...
